Output 19aa310905ce4100a5ead24928b2c4576d5b88653f9d54f4d3d9ada5858bd0b7:0

value
5192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23cf39393ae6f1ff6d6cdcaf4ab9755f6b2d4afd OP_EQUAL
address
34xMpQDSKuz8UNjCy2V9BZ2SKF1D1ro5bi
transaction
19aa310905ce4100a5ead24928b2c4576d5b88653f9d54f4d3d9ada5858bd0b7
confirmations
313467
spent
true